1976 NFL Draft - Hall of Famers

Hall of Famers

  • Steve Largent, Wide Receiver from Tulsa taken 4th round 117th overall by the Houston Oilers.
Inducted: Professional Football Hall of Fame Class of 1995.
  • Lee Roy Selmon, Defensive End from Oklahoma taken 1st round 1st overall by the Tampa Bay Buccaneers.
Inducted: Professional Football Hall of Fame Class of 1995.
  • Mike Haynes, Cornerback from Arizona State taken 1st round 5th overall by the New England Patriots.
Inducted: Professional Football Hall of Fame Class of 1997.
  • Jackie Slater, Offensive Tackle from Jackson State taken 3rd round 86th overall by the Los Angeles Rams.
Inducted: Professional Football Hall of Fame Class of 2001.
  • Harry Carson, Linebacker from South Carolina State taken 4th round 105th overall by the New York Giants.
Inducted: Professional Football Hall of Fame Class of 2006.
